Best 22025 Virginia Public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 3 public schools serving 2,316 students in 22025, VA (there are , serving 43 private students). 98% of all K-12 students in 22025, VA are educated in public schools (compared to the VA state average of 89%).
The top-ranked public schools in 22025, VA are A. Henderson Elementary School, John F. Pattie Sr. Elementary School and Montclair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 22025 have an average math proficiency score of 81% (versus the Virginia public school average of 68%), and reading proficiency score of 73% (versus the 70% statewide average). Schools in 22025, VA have an average ranking of 8/10, which is in the top 30% of Virginia public schools.
Minority enrollment is 70%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Black), which is more than the Virginia public school average of 56% (majority Black and Hispanic).
